Abstract: The present invention relates to a novel method for the affinity purification of proteins of interest in a single step, based on the lectin activity of the CRD (Carbohydrate Recognition Domain) of a galectin or part of said domain retaining the ability to bind ?-galactosidase derivative.

Abstract: A method is provided for identifying an isthmus in a three-dimensional map of a cardiac cavity by means of a processing unit configured to perform the following steps: a) correlation between a set of stimulated points of the cardiac cavity, each stimulated point being represented by a set of signals that are obtained following surface electrocardiography (ECG), excluding ventricular tachycardia; b) identification of a watershed line on the basis of the above correlation results and of the 3D coordinates of the stimulated points in the 3D map; and c) determination of the isthmus based on a 3D corridor substantially transverse to the watershed line.

Abstract: A method is provided for determining a personalized cardiac model, including steps of (i) computing a velocity time profile of a blood flow across a selected area of the heart or the aorta during at least one cardiac cycle, using data acquired with a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) device; (ii) performing a segmentation of the velocity time profile so as to identify cardiac phases according to a predefined generic cardiac model; and (iii) computing normalized time location and/or duration of the cardiac phases within cardiac cycles so as to define a personalized cardiac model.

Abstract: A method is provided of reconstructing imaging signals in a biological medium on the basis of experimental measurements perturbed by movements, implementing measurements representative of the movements, at least one model of movement including movement parameters, and an imaging sampling grid, which method furthermore includes steps of (i) constructing a movement sampling grid by selecting a restricted set of points on the basis of the imaging sampling grid, and (ii) calculation of movement parameters by inverting a linear system at the points of the movement sampling grid. Devices implementing the method are also disclosed.
